W: I can see by your resume here that you studied business administration.
M: That’s right.
W: So I wonder why you want to work for a newspaper.
M: [1]I did reporting for the university newspaper at my school. And I’ve always been very interested in journalism.
W: But journalism—it’s a very different profession from administration. You know a lot about administration. Why don’t you choose to work for a company looking for train managers?
M: I studied administration, yes, but I am more attracted to writing articles. [2]I want to use my knowledge of business to write financial news.
W: A new reporter must expect to work many hours.
M: I know that the profession requires dedication.
W: You should expect to work more than fifty hours a week. And there is a lot of pressure in this job. You have to get stories in by the deadline.
M: I know that beginning reporters work many hours. [3]I am very willing to take on the challenge.
W: May I ask how well you know the city?
M: I grew up here.
W: But you went to college in Seattle. So you haven’t lived here for almost five years, yes?
M: Yes, that’s true. But I grew up on the north side of town. And I know this city very well. I have no trouble getting where I need to go.
W: That’s good. [4] Because if you’re hired, we will be sending you everywhere. The job is in the city news department.
M: Yes, I’m aware of that.
W: Alright, then. We will probably be giving you a call in ten days or so. I have to interview several more people.
M: Thank you, Mrs. Jones.
1. Why does the man want to work for a newspaper?
2. What kind of articles does the man want to write?
3. What is the man’s reaction to the working hours mentioned by the woman?
4. Why does the woman ask the man if he knows the city well?
选项
A、She only wants to hire local people.
B、She lived in the city for a long time.
C、She will send the employees everywhere.
D、She wants to know more about applicants.
答案
C
解析
女士问男士对这座城市有多少了解,男士说他在这里长大,虽然去了西雅图读书,但他还是十分了解这座城市,知道每个方位。随后女士解释说,如果聘用男士,会把他派往各个地点。可见C正确。
